1) Connect the DVI-D signal cable to the signal port of the Graphic Card in your computer.
2) Connect the another connector of the DVI-D signal cable on the rear side of the monitor.
3) Connect the power cord to the AC inlet on the rear side of the monitor
4) Try to collect the cable and power cord like the below pictures
5) Turn on the monitor with the power switch of the user control port.
All LCD monitors need time to become thermally stable whenever you turn on the monitor
After letting the monitor be turned off for a couple of hours.
Therefore, to achieve more accurate adjustments for parameters, allow the LCD monitor to be
Warmed up for at least 20 minutes before making any screen adjustments.
